PALAPYE: The deceased Dineo Baitsemi, who had been at the centre of a court feud due to differences between her natal and her matrimonial families, has finally been laid to rest at Mmaphula cemeteries.

Baitsemi died on February 27, and traditionally she would have been buried on the weekend of the week she departed.

Initially, funeral arrangements were scheduled for her matrimonial home in Mmadinare. The process was interdicted by the courts of law after her natal family disputed the development. She was in the process of a divorce at the time of her demise. The court, therefore, ruled she be buried at her natal home.
